Over the past decade, the landscape of online gambling and digital entertainment has undergone a profound transformation. Traditional slot machines, once solely relying on luck, are increasingly integrating elements of skill and interactivity to cater to modern players seeking a more engaging experience. This evolution not only reflects shifting consumer preferences but also illustrates how technological innovation is redefining industry standards.
Understanding the Shift: From Pure Chance to Player Agency
While classic Slot games primarily hinge on chance, the advent of skill-based mechanics introduces a new dimension of agency for players. This hybrid model combines traditional random outcomes with skill elements, enabling players to influence results through decisions, quick reflexes, and strategic thinking.
Market Dynamics and Consumer Appeal
Recent industry data indicates that the global online gambling market value stood at approximately $66.7 billion in 2022 and is projected to grow at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of around 11% through 2027 (Statista, 2023). A significant driver of this growth is the rising popularity of skill games—particularly among younger audiences who favour more interactive forms of entertainment.

Technological Foundations Supporting Skill-Enhanced Slots
Advances in game development, including HTML5 technology, real-time data analytics, and adaptive algorithms, underpin this shift. Developers harness machine learning to tailor difficulty levels, ensuring that players remain challenged without frustration.
